How to Downgrade iOS 5 to iOS 4.3.3 (Full Tutorial)

Updating to the latest iOS 5 is very interesting but if you think that the tethered jailbreak is quite annoying, you downgrade your iDevices from iOS 5 to iOS 4.3.3. It works with iPhone, iPod Touch and iPad (some not work). You just need to have saved your SHSH in Cydia servers (mandatory).

Downgrade Downgrade IOS 5 to IOS 4.3.3

Note: You can also download a previous version if you have the SHSH of that version.

Note: This makes a jailbreak only iPhone version, not the baseband, we can not lower the baseband.

Requirement:

1. Last iTunes available
2. Firmware 4.3.3
3. TinyUmbrella

Here are the instructions:

First of all open TinyUmbrella, go to “Advance” and select this option: turn them to close, this will modify your host file automatically.

Step 1: Open TinyUmbrella and connect your device.

Step 2. Click the Start button TSS Server (iTunes will close automatically)

Step 3. Open iTunes and click SHIFT + Restore for Windows or Alt + Restore for Mac.

Step 4. Select the iOS 4.3.3, you downloaded.

Begin the restoration, not close TinyUmbrella

If all has gone well, you can go to and press Stop TinyUmbrella TSS Server.

Did you come 10xx error and has been in recovery mode?

Go to TinyUmbrella and click Exit Recovery

Wait until your device restarts

Are you still in recovery mode?

Put the iPhone into DFU mode, iTunes will display a warning “iPhone detected in recovery mode”

To put the iPhone in DFU, connect to your computer and turn it off, press the Home button and power simultaneously for 10 seconds, 10 seconds past the stop pressing the power button, but continue pressing the Home button until iTunes a message saying it has detected an iPhone in recovery mode.

Once in DFU, see Recovery Fix TinyUmbrella and click your device and restart.

Missing the 3194?

Uninstall iTunes and reinstall it, if this does not fix your error try a different computer.
